Touring cycling around Cuttura, located in the Jura department of Burgundy-Franche-Comté, offers diverse landscapes for outdoor exploration. The region features a tranquil setting with natural beauty, characterized by glacial lakes and dramatic gorges. Cyclists will find varied topography, from winding roads through forests to routes alongside impressive waterfalls and geological formations within the Jura Mountains. This area provides a compelling backdrop for touring cycling routes.

Lake L'Abbaye in the Jura Mountains is surrounded by hills and forests. Its clear waters reflect the landscape, offering a peaceful setting for boating, fishing, and hiking. Unfortunately, swimming is not permitted.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many touring cycling routes are available around Cuttura?

There are over 100 touring cycling routes around Cuttura, offering a wide range of options for exploration. These routes are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.4 stars from over 80 reviews.

What kind of terrain can I expect on touring cycling routes in Cuttura?

The region around Cuttura offers diverse terrain, from tranquil roads winding through green forests to more challenging routes alongside dramatic gorges and past glacial lakes. You'll encounter varied topography characteristic of the Jura Mountains, providing both gentle paths and more demanding climbs.

What do other cyclists enjoy most about touring cycling in Cuttura?

The komoot community highly rates the touring cycling routes in Cuttura, with an average score of 4.4 stars. Cyclists often praise the region's natural beauty, including its glacial lakes and dramatic gorges, as well as the varied terrain that caters to different skill levels.

Are there touring cycling routes suitable for beginners or families in Cuttura?

Yes, Cuttura offers options for all skill levels. While many routes are moderate or difficult, there are at least 8 easy touring cycling routes available. These routes often follow gentler paths, making them suitable for beginners or families looking for a more relaxed ride.

Are there challenging touring cycling routes for experienced cyclists in Cuttura?

Absolutely. For experienced cyclists seeking a challenge, Cuttura boasts a significant number of difficult routes, with over 59 options available. These routes often feature substantial elevation changes and cover longer distances, such as the 90.3-mile (145.3 km) Lac de Lamoura – Tunnel in the cliff loop from Saint-Claude, which includes over 2,500 meters of ascent.

What natural attractions can I see along the touring cycling routes in Cuttura?

The Cuttura region is rich in natural beauty. Along your rides, you can discover impressive waterfalls like the Flumen Waterfall and Combes Waterfall. You might also encounter dramatic geological formations such as the Gorges of the Abyss and the expansive views from Dog's Leap.

Are there any circular touring cycling routes around Cuttura?

Yes, many of the touring cycling routes around Cuttura are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. Examples include the moderate Great view above Prénovel – Great view loop from Ravilloles and the more challenging Grandvaux Abbey – Abbey Lake loop from Coteaux du Lizon.

What are some notable viewpoints or scenic spots accessible by touring bike?

The region offers several breathtaking viewpoints. Dog's Leap provides expansive views over a gorge, showcasing the region's geology. Another excellent spot is the Panorama on the Chamois Trail, offering picturesque vistas. Routes like the Great view above Prénovel – Great view loop from Ravilloles are specifically designed to highlight these scenic spots.

Can I connect to longer regional cycling routes from Cuttura?

While Cuttura itself is a tranquil base, its location within the Jura Mountains means you are well-positioned to access or connect with larger regional cycling networks. The area's diverse terrain and scenic roads are part of the broader Jura cycling landscape, which includes routes like the Grande Traversée du Jura.

What is the best time of year for touring cycling in Cuttura?

The best time for touring cycling in Cuttura is generally during the warmer months, from late spring to early autumn. This period offers pleasant temperatures and allows for full enjoyment of the region's natural features, including its waterfalls and lakes. Winter cycling might be possible but would require specific gear due to potential snow and colder conditions in the Jura Mountains.

Are there any routes that pass by lakes or water features?

Yes, the Cuttura area is known for its glacial lakes and impressive waterfalls. Routes such as the Lac de Lamoura – Les Rousses loop from Saint-Claude will take you past serene water bodies. The Grandvaux Abbey – Abbey Lake loop from Coteaux du Lizon also leads through areas featuring glacial lakes, offering picturesque views and refreshing stops.
